CELTIC misfit Teemu Pukki admits he's tempted to stay at Brondby after netting his fifth goal in just four games since moving to Denmark.
The Finnish hitman is a key player for the Copenhagen side and can't stop scoring since moving on deadline day.
Brondby fans are already demanding their board makes the move permanent in January and Pukki said: "Right know I am concentrating on enjoying my football and just thinking about the next match.
"If something happened with a permanent transfer, I would have to make a decision."
Brondby sports director Per Rud isaid: "The situation with Pukki is that we can wait until the summer before making our mind up about a transfer - he is staying with us until then.
"What I can say is that he has started very promisingly for us."
